      At a far front corner of the yard there are plantings I call my electric garden.  These plants were here when we moved in, and they surround a large electrical box.

     This is the garden in mid-May.  Two red Scotch broom shrubs bloom at the  back corners of the electrical box.  Scotch broom is considered invasive in some states, particularly out west.






front of  box
     At the front of the box in mid-May daisies and milkweed are starting to grow.


mid-June
     In mid-June the Scotch broom is done blooming, and the daisies and milkweed are starting to blossom.
    
July
     Now in July, the daisies and milkweed are in fulll bloom.

milkweed blossom
     Here is a close-up of a milkweed blossom.  The bees love it.
